Maybe the RELEASE YES is because the file has not been loaded with idcams  
REPRO.  Also, a few other items you might consider:

1. Change the DATA CISIZE to 26624 as this will save about 11% of disk and 
change the INDEX CISIZE to 4096.  I have successfully used these on many files.
2. Change the FSPC(5,5) to FSPC(0,5) or some effective value.  The first 5 is 
for ci free space and is 5% of the current cisize of 8192 = 409 which is less 
than the record size, so no records will fit in the free space.
3. Change the DATACLASS to SPEED vs. RECOVERY as this causes the REPRO to run 
faster due to no formatting/checkpoints.

When an IAM file is created with the VSAM EXTENDED format the IAM Global 
Options value for RELEASE= is used for the RELEASE setting on the file.  
The default Global Option for RELEASE= is YES.
Once an IAM file is loaded, space in this file is released and the 
RELEASE setting on the file is set to NO.

> I defined the dsn as VSAM EXTENDED format and I ran a LISTCAT to compare the 
> before and after allocation.
> Everything is okay except for the following:
> When the dsn was NOT VSAM EXTENDED format the IAM100 IAM FILE ANALYSIS output 
> showed :
>
> TOTAL EXTENTS  =        49  -  TOTAL SPACE ALLOCATED - =   1956000 TRACKS
> PRIMARY SPACE  =      4350  -  SECONDARY SPACE ------- =      4350 CYL
> MULTIVOLUME -- =   PRIMARY  -  MAX SECONDARY --------- =      4350 CYL
> RELEASE ------ =        NO  -  SHARE OPTIONS --------- =         2
> DATA COMPRESS  =  SOFTWARE  -  INDEX COMPRESS -------- =       YES
> TOTAL RECORDS  = 447700657  -  INSERTS --------------- =         0
> UPDATES ------ =         0  -  DELETES --------------- =         0
> HIGH USED RBA  = 104538978  -  HIGH ALLOCATED RBA ---- = 104538978 KB
> FILE DEFINED - =  2014.298  -  10/25/2014 -  6:26 PM - =  18:26:54
> FILE LOADED -- =  2014.298  -  10/25/2014 -  6:53 PM - =  18:53:07
>
> However when the dsn is defined as VSAM EXTENDED it shows
> TOTAL EXTENTS  =         2  -  TOTAL SPACE ALLOCATED - =     95250 TRACKS
> PRIMARY SPACE  =      6350  -  SECONDARY SPACE ------- =      6350 CYL
> MULTIVOLUME -- =   PRIMARY  -  MAX SECONDARY --------- =      6350 CYL
> RELEASE ------ =       YES  -  SHARE OPTIONS --------- =         2
> FILE DEFINED - =  2014.300  -  10/27/2014 -  1:17 PM - =  13:17:06
> NUMBER OF IAM DATA BLOCKS -------------------- =         0
> EXTENDED HIGH ALLOCATED RBN ------------------ =         0
>
> I cannot understand why it is showing RELEASE ------ =       YES ?  I thought 
> it could be coming from
> Space Constraint Relief . . . : YES
> I tried a test and changed the Space Constraint Relief . . . : NO however the 
> result was the same.
>
> Could someone shed some light?
